Golden Lane Housing Board makes new appointments

January 10, 2025

The Board of Golden Lane Housing (GLH) is pleased to announce the appointment of two highly experienced sector leaders to its Board on 17th December 2024. Additionally, Chief Executive John Verge will also become an Executive member of the Board, further enhancing the organisation’s strategic leadership.

 

The election of Steve Secker to the role of Chair of the Board and Jason Ridley as Chair of the Risk and Audit Committee will strengthen Golden Lane Housing’s ability to deliver its mission of helping people with a learning disability and autistic people find and enjoy a suitable, safe home.

Steve Secker

Steve Secker is an experienced non-executive director who has also served as a Managing Director at McCarthy and Stone. Steve’s deep understanding of supported housing services and his focus on impactful change fully align with Golden Lane Housing’s vision and mission.

Jason Ridley

Jason Ridley brings an extensive financial background, with executive and board-level experience across the social housing sector. Jason’s expertise in financial stewardship and governance will be instrumental in leading the Risk and Audit Committee. His insight, clarity, and knowledge will play a key role in supporting the organisation’s growth and impact.

 

Both Steve and Jason have personal ties to the work of Golden Lane Housing, as each is a parent of an adult child with a learning disability. This common experience enhances their leadership with a deep sense of empathy and commitment.

 

Their induction has already started, with both attending the annual Making Plans Day with tenants, Board, and Executive colleagues, focusing on priorities for the next three years.

The appointments also see Chief Executive John Verge take on the additional role of an Executive member of the Board. This dual role underscores the importance of strong collaboration between the Executive team and the Board in driving forward Golden Lane Housing’s strategic goals.

 

These changes coincide with long-standing Board members Neil Hadden and Stephen Jack completing their terms as Chair and Chair of the Risk and Audit Committee, respectively. Under their leadership, Golden Lane Housing has made significant strides in delivering innovative housing solutions and enhancing the lives of people with learning disabilities and autistic people. The Board extends its heartfelt gratitude to Neil and Stephen for their exceptional dedication and unwavering commitment, which have laid a strong foundation for future growth and success.
